Jimmy Moreland was one of Redskins’ biggest winners vs. Browns

Washington Redskins seventh-round pick Jimmy Moreland just won’t stop making noise since his arrival.

This trend continued against the Cleveland Browns, as Moreland broke up a touchdown pass and forced two fumbles, among other highlights.

He’s happy coming out of the performance, to say the least.

“Once I’m getting it going, once I get in a groove, I just feel energized,” Moreland said, according to Kareem Copeland and Les Carpenter of the Washington Post. “I feel up. I’m ready to go now. … It was very exciting for me.”

Leading up to the game, some had suggested Moreland reminds them of Kendall Fuller. He also took the time to have some standout practices in camp.

Moreland has had a cult following of sorts in Washington since his arrival. He’s a bit smaller (5’10”, 179 lbs) but already showing he can have an NFL-level impact, which will only increase the number of his supporters.

If Moreland can string a few more games together like this, he’s going to make the lives of those in charge of forging a 53-man roster rather difficult.
